What is Artificial Intelligence?
Artificial Intelligence refers to the simulation of human intelligence in machines that are programmed to think, reason, learn, and adapt. These machines can perform tasks such as visual perception, speech recognition, decision-making, and even language translation.
AI is a multidisciplinary field that draws from computer science, mathematics, statistics, neuroscience, and linguistics. It is categorized into several branches including:
-
Machine Learning (ML)
-
Natural Language Processing (NLP)
-
Computer Vision
-
Robotics
-
Expert Systems

AI Tools and Technologies for Beginners
BCA students can start with tools like:
-
Python – The go-to language for AI and ML due to its simplicity and robust libraries (NumPy, Pandas, Scikit-learn).
-
Google Colab – A free cloud-based environment for training AI models.
-
TensorFlow/Keras – Libraries for building deep learning models.
-
ChatGPT & MidJourney – Examples of advanced generative AI for text and images, respectively.
Real-World Applications of AI
-
Healthcare: Disease diagnosis, drug discovery, personalized treatment plans.
-
Education: AI tutors, adaptive learning platforms, plagiarism detection.
-
Finance: Fraud detection, credit scoring, algorithmic trading.
-
E-commerce: Recommendation engines, chatbots, demand forecasting.
